"textContent": "The internal combustion engine (1) has a compressor (5) for compressing the air fed into the engine, whereby a defined desired charging pressure is adjusted via a final control element (10) in a bypass (15) to the compressor. A desired air mass flow through the bypass is determined from the desired charging pressure and a desired value for the position of the final control element is derived from the desired air mass flow through the bypass. An independent claim is also included for the following: (a) an arrangement for operating an internal combustion engine.",
